    Design Teacher

    Department: Education

    Direct Supervisor: Head of Teaching & Learning

    Contract: Temporary, Renewable  

    Compensation: Dependent on experience

    You will also have the opportunity to complement those classes with a modest number of introductory ICT classes. We do not require qualifications or experience in ICT teaching, but you must demonstrate interest and competence in everyday computer usage.

    You join Still I Rise with a clear pathway of growth and promotion. We offer extensive professional development in a wide range of areas as well as full sponsorship of your participation in official IB training workshops. 

    We therefore hire proactive educators who demonstrate genuine care for each child, a hunger to offer them the best, and an infectious passion for the curricular and extracurricular activities they lead. 

    If you are a qualified teacher and this sounds like a challenge which suits you, we warmly invite you to apply!

    K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

    • Plan, deliver and facilitate dynamic, active, and creative Design lessons for diverse classes of students aged 10-15. Create enhanced opportunities for real-life applications of concepts using available resources and project based learning.
    • Plan and deliver introductory ICT classes on a weekly basis.
    • Review and monitor the progress of all students and identify their individual learning needs. Differentiate instruction to meet those needs of the students, providing extra support to those students who are below grade level.
    • Sensitively and appropriately provide pastoral care to our students from disadvantaged backgrounds. Handle urgent situations with consummate professionalism and in accordance with our Discipline Policy and Safeguarding Policy, utilising the school’s support network as necessary.
    • Conduct regular formative and summative assessments, recording and reporting grades and performance.
    • Attend and participate in regular professional development activities.
    • Help our school excel with your participation and leadership in community engagement, competitions, school trips and other activities.
    • Contribute to the development and leadership of our extracurricular programmes.
    • Under the supervision of the Head of Teaching and Learning, provide feedback on quality and wellbeing to ensure programmes are designed, implemented, monitored, and evaluated to maximise positive impact on vulnerable children.

    ESSENTIAL CRITERIA

    • Demonstrate the attributes of the “IB Profile” (https://www.ibo.org/benefits/learner-profile/), in particular ‘risk-takers’, ‘open-minded’ and ‘reflective’;
    • Excellent written and oral English 
    • Academic or Professional Certificates;
    • Completion of CRB/Background check;
    • Bachelor’s degree in Design, Science, ICT, Education or related field or equivalent training and experience;
    • At least two years of teaching experience;
    • Competent ICT skills;
    • Excellent interpersonal, communication and organisational skills;
    • Ability to mentor students on a daily basis;
    • Resilience in a challenging and changing environment;
    • The curiosity and willingness to develop and practise modern teaching techniques;
    • Determined team player.

    DESIRABLE CRITERIA 

    • Experience teaching low-achieving students
    • Experience working with refugee populations
    • Experience working with vulnerable people
    • Experience in Child Safeguarding and Protection
    • Teaching Service Commission (TSC) Number ​​​​​​​
